Meaning & Definition

Primary Meaning:
In slang, “based” generally refers to someone who is unapologetically authentic or expresses opinions without worrying about social approval. When someone says, “That’s based,” they are complimenting the person for being real and confident.

Secondary Meanings:

  • Respect for honesty: Someone who speaks their mind without sugarcoating.
  • Admiration for courage: Expressing an unpopular opinion confidently.
  • Internet culture context: Often used humorously or sarcastically to highlight boldness.

Quick Examples:

  • “She told the teacher exactly what she thought—so based.”
  • “Posting that hot take online? Based, man.”

Background & Origin

The term “based” gained prominence in modern slang thanks to rapper Lil B, who often referred to himself as “The Based God.” Originally, “based” had a negative meaning in older slang, implying someone was “base” or socially unconventional, often drug-influenced. Lil B flipped the term, giving it a positive meaning associated with freedom of thought and self-confidence. Since then, it spread widely through forums, memes, and social media, particularly on Twitter, Reddit, and TikTok.

Usage in Different Contexts

Chat & Social Media:
“Based” is commonly used in casual conversations to praise someone’s opinion or action.

  • Example: “He called out the nonsense in that meeting—so based 👏”

Professional Fields:
Less common professionally, but it can appear in informal work chats to commend someone’s honesty or bold suggestions.

  • Example: “Her presentation was based—she didn’t sugarcoat the results.”

Memes & Humor:
The word is often exaggerated in memes to show ironic admiration.

Common Misconceptions & Mistakes

  • Mistaking “based” for “cool” or “trendy” (it’s about authenticity, not style).
  • Assuming it always has positive connotations; sarcasm can flip it.
  • Confusing it with “basing” in technical fields.
